Berkeley, Michael - Wessex Graves
Catalogue No: 9780193451520
£15.75
Printed on demand, typically dispatched in 3-4 weeks
for tenor and harp These songs are among Berkeley's earliest compositions, written in the mid-1970s at the suggestion and encouragement of Peter Pears. The poems, by Thomas Hardy, were chosen for various treatments of one theme - death, and the grave. Some are wistful, some tragic, some humorous.
